/** * Search Tools - MCP Tools for Things App Search Commands * * This module defines MCP tools that handle search operations in the Things app. * Search functionality allows users to find existing content across all their * to-dos, projects, areas, and other Things data. */ /** * Create and return all search-related MCP tools * * This factory function creates tool objects configured with a specific * ThingsClient instance for performing search operations. * * @param {ThingsClient} thingsClient - Configured Things client instance * @returns {Array} - Array of MCP tool objects */ export function createSearchTools(thingsClient) { return [ { name: "search", description: "Search for content in Things app. Opens Things and displays search results for the given query across all to-dos, projects, and areas.", // JSON Schema defining the input parameters for search inputSchema: { type: "object", properties: { query: { type: "string", description: "The search query to find in Things content", minLength: 1 } }, required: ["query"], }, /** * Handler function for the search tool * * This function validates the search query and uses the ThingsClient * to perform a search in the Things app. The search will open Things * and display results matching the query. * * @param {Object} args - Arguments passed from the MCP client * @returns {Promise<string>} - Success or error message */ handler: async (args) => { try { // Validate that Things is available if (!thingsClient.isThingsAvailable()) { throw new Error("Things app is not available. Make sure you're running on macOS and Things is installed."); } // Validate required fields if (!args.query || typeof args.query !== 'string' || args.query.trim() === '') { throw new Error("Search query is required and must be a non-empty string"); } // Clean up the search query const searchQuery = args.query.trim(); // Execute the search command const success = await thingsClient.search(searchQuery); if (success) { return `Successfully performed search for: "${searchQuery}". Things app is now showing search results.`; } else { throw new Error("Failed to perform search in Things app"); } } catch (error) { const errorMessage = `Failed to search: ${error.message}`; console.error(errorMessage); throw new Error(errorMessage); } }, }, ]; }
